Output 088b63348b101f5386999bf22b5a2898b1381c8e697a9047aabd24cc625b073e:1

value
6485074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a78abace35377cde2094ba962d65f163f742e3d OP_EQUAL
address
3CravHeTYsQrc6mgESBH2tAKnfsAAqFkVE
transaction
088b63348b101f5386999bf22b5a2898b1381c8e697a9047aabd24cc625b073e
confirmations
531337
spent
true